IFS Customer Engagement
Score 8.8 out of 10
N/A
IFS Customer Engagement is based on the mplSystems Omni-Channel Contact Centre, now owned and supported by IFS since the August 2017 acquisition. It contains workforce optimization with messaging and email support emphasizing the needs of outbound call centers.N/A

Additional DetailsA Conversica subscription includes an unlimited number of seats for marketers, sales reps and managers. Different editions include different levels of functionality to match your needs. The service is a monthly subscription with an annual commitment.

Conversica
Conversica is an excellent tool if you have a large database of potential students, sales leads, or other forms of potential customers/users. It does not replace human interaction, but instead supplements it - allowing your admissions/sales/retention team to spend their time with those individuals that are in most need of assistance - whether that be because they are "hot leads" for a sale, students with a sincere interest, or customers needing assistance beyond the capabilities of an automatic system.

Cons
Conversica
  • The method of standing up campaigns can be a little tedious for administrators because it uses copy/paste of Salesforce Campaign ID instead of just searching for active Salesforce campaigns.
  • Understanding the conversation path options that the AI could take is improving greatly, but can still use some improvements for admin awareness when standing up a new conversation.
  • Understanding what conversation types exist and how they differ from one another is sometimes difficult to self-serv, but the Conversica team is always very good about helping out explaining these.

Implementation Rating
Conversica
The implementation went smoothly. The only advice I would give for anybody looking to integrate Conversica with Salesforce is to ensure that either you or somebody within your organization has experience with process builder as you'll need to create some processes to force your leads into Salesforce campaigns for the Conversica system to pick them up.
